Output e15f64f3a09799dee39786070955998cca54f7ddc41ea63ce21ed8ea6054236e:16

value
1508878
script pubkey
OP_0 OP_PUSHBYTES_20 5ae9cb7f2fe6088e156642160b71dffcaba1e715
address
bc1qtt5ukle0ucygu9txggtqkuwllj46rec4advqw5
transaction
e15f64f3a09799dee39786070955998cca54f7ddc41ea63ce21ed8ea6054236e